android-alarms

    0

    1答えて

    ユーザーが選択した特定の時刻に、6 '/ 7'/8 'のように毎日通知をトリガーします。 このため、通知を作成するためにIntentServiceに渡すWakefulBroadcastReceiverを作成しました。 これは私のAlarmsManagerの設定方法です。 timeInHoursは6と12の間にパラメータとして渡された整数、次のとおりです。 Intent i = new Intent

    -1

    1答えて

    私は1日の特定の時間にトリガするアラーム通知を繰り返す必要があります。私が作った反復アラームは、アラームをうまく発していますが、時にはその設定時間に消えることもあります。たとえば、私は午前6時にアラームを設定しましたが、翌日の翌6時15分にトリガした後、アラームを設定する方法がより正確かどうか疑問に思っていましたか?ここ 私の繰り返しアラームAndroid Developersから Calend

    2

    2答えて

    Androidアプリは、ユーザーが特定の時刻に通知を送信して日々の計画に従うのを支援します。このタスクはJobSchedulerで簡単に解決できます。それは簡単で、軽く、最新の解決策のようです。 私が苦労しているのは、毎日すべての通知を計画する方法です。私はユーザの毎日の計画をチェックし、毎日午前0時に静かに通知をスケジュールするコードを実行する必要があります。これまでに2つのアプローチが見つかり

    -1

    1答えて

    Android 6.0+でバッテリーの「改善」が追加されたため、基本的には詰まっています。私のアプリは、サードパーティのサーバーのWebサービスからデータをフェッチ:私のアプリは11+ シナリオ ここに私のシナリオだからAPIをサポートしています。それは私のサーバーではないので、データの追加や削除を制御することはできません。データの可用性はさまざまです。 IntentServiceを起動してデータ

    0

    1答えて

    私は繰り返しアラームを設定するアプリケーションで作業しています。 私のサービスの1つを2分ごとに実行することになっています。 myApplicationアクティビティを実行しても正常に動作しますが、他のアプリケーションがフォアグラウンドで実行されている場合、間隔は5分になります!!! 私はこのコードをフォアグラウンドで開始している別のサービスの中で実行します。 なぜこのようなことが起こっているのか

    0

    1答えて

    私のアプリはヒューマンアクティビティ認識を実行しており、十分にアクティブでない場合にユーザーに通知しています。私は常に実行中の前景サービスで加速度計のデータを読んでいます。私が睡眠中にサービスを開始および停止しようとしている(たとえば、ユーザーが睡眠時間間隔を午後8時から午前8時に設定している)ので、指定された時間後にサービスを停止して再び開始する必要があります。現在、次のコードは機能しません。理

    -2

    1答えて

    私は1日、3日、7日、28日のように異なる時刻にアラームを設定する必要があるプロジェクトに取り組んでいますユーザーがアプリを離れました。 は、私は私が最終的にこれを達成するために管理 Calendar calendar2 = Calendar.getInstance(); calendar2.set(Calendar.HOUR_OF_DAY, 16); calendar2

    0

    1答えて

    正常に機能し、アラームがトリガされたときに通知を表示するバックグラウンドアラームサービスがあります。 通知を表示するのではなく、アプリケーションがバックグラウンドになっている場合でも、ページを表示するようにしました。 Android、ドキュメントを見ると、これはXamarin.Androidを使用して達成可能であることがわかります。 だから私はここに二つの質問持っている:通知をタップしたユーザーせ

    1

    1答えて

    私は少し問題があります。私が助けてくれれば非常に感謝しています。私はクライアント薬のためのローカルデータベースのようなアプリを持っています。ピルを追加するときに、特定のピルを取る必要があるときに通知を追加することができます。彼は1時間しか設定できず、その週から数日を選択することができます。だから、アプリは、その特定の時間に毎日のためのアラームをしている、私のアプリは多くのアラームを作っている、私は

    0

    1答えて

    私のアプリは、ユーザがボタンをクリックしてから12または24時間後にmyAction()を実行する必要があります。 は、long引数が実際の時刻ではなく、uptimeに基づいているため、使用できません。 だから私は、私はちょうどTimerTask/TimerまたはAlarmManagerが残っていますと思いますが、私は最も適切であろうこれらのかわからないんだけど - プラス、私はそれが信頼できない